Meaning of "chief of artillery"
chief of artillery - This phrase is a military rank or position that is responsible for overseeing and directing the artillery forces of a military unit or organization. The chief of artillery is in charge of planning and coordinating the deployment, use, and maintenance of artillery weapons and equipment during combat operations
